For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public preschools serving 581 students in 04730, ME.
The top-ranked public preschools in 04730, ME are Mill Pond School and Houlton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public preschools in zipcode 04730 have an average math proficiency score of 72% (versus the Maine public pre school average of 52%), and reading proficiency score of 92% (versus the 82% statewide average). Pre schools in 04730, ME have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of Maine public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 16% of the student body (majority American Indian), which is more than the Maine public preschool average of 14% (majority Black).
